The English football league system, also known as the football pyramid, is a series of interconnected leagues for men's association football clubs in England, with five teams from Wales, one from Guernsey, one from Jersey and one from the Isle of Man also competing. The system has a hierarchical format with … See more The world's first association football league, named simply The Football League, was created in 1888 by Aston Villa's club director William McGregor.
